    This was at 4:30am this morning...

    I live in a relatively nice neighborhood in Suwanee. The other neighborhoods around me are nice, upper middle class as well. It's not the type of place that you would think of for "crime" or "burglaries" and whatnot.

    I was shutting up the house to go to bed and happened to look out of my front window (to see if it was still snowing/raining/sleeting) to see a teenage kid with a hoodie going into the cars across the street. Both were open (doors unlocked), so he was going through the glovebox/center console for both. I ran upstairs, grabbed my pistol, put it into the small of my back (just 'cause you never know what is going to happen) and grabbed my cell phone.

    I walked outside (I probably should have just called the cops and observed, but since I know this neighbor, I didn't want them to fuck their cars up and/or steal anymore stuff) and confronted one of the kids. Eh, hindsight is 20/20 I guess. The other one was already up the street trying to find other unlocked cars.

    I crossed the street and asked told the kid to freeze. He didn't. He slowly started walking, got to the side of the house, and sprinted. I gave chase, but he started hoping fences/rocks/etc.

    I cut back around the side of the house and ran down the street to cut him off. He was nowhere to be found (I guess he was hiding)? While I was looking, I see his buddy cut across the street further down and go through the woods. I was on the phone with 911 at the time, but couldn't see exactly where the kids went (it was dark and there was a HUGE dropoff that they had to jump down to get away - I'll be shocked if neither of them are hurt from doing so in all honesty).

    While I'm waiting for the cops (this is 4:22am in the morning mind you), I see a car come into the neighborhood. Thinking that it was the cops, I walked out into the street. The car immediately stopped, turned around, jumped a curb, and then sped off. I am guessing that the kids called this car to pick them up or something.

    Three cop cars showed up and went searching for the kids, but they didn't find them. From what the cops told us, this is one of the most common thefts in the area. It's typically teenage/early 20s white kids that go car to car looking for vehicles that are unlocked. They never break windows or anything like that, however.

    Given the area that I live in (low crime, no rapes, no murders, 97% white, upper middle class), most people are very trusting. They leave their vehicles unlocked and whatnot as there is very little crime here. You just have teenage kids that do this around 2-5am in the morning. The police handle these type of thefts all the time around here.

    The kid that I confronted was in his late teens, shorter, white male, had a dark hoodie on, and a small backpack. The other kid in the red shirt that went up the street looked to be white as well.

    Go figure. Oh well, I've done my good deed for the night.

    Those are usually older actually. Most of the door checkers are just your average shitty teenager. Someone drops them off, they go down the street checking car doors and steal from any that are unlocked, then get picked up. It's become really popular the past year or so.
